Energy consumption calculation the energy e in kilowatt hours kwh per day is equal to the power p in watts w times number of usage hours per day t divided by 1000 watts per kilowatt. When designing for total server power consumption a kw per rack approach is more useful than watts per square foot which hasn t been a valid measurement for years.
